Korte biografie
Msgr. George J. Moorman was born in 1883 at Indiana, where he spent the majority of his life. He was ordained a priest on the thirteenth of June, 1908, by Bishop Herman J. Alerding at the Cathedral of the Immaculate Conception. He remained a priest for over seventy years, serving as an editor of Our Sunday Visitor and an army chaplain during the first World War. Father Moorman died in 1979 at the age of 95.

This book is excellent as an introduction to someone wanting to learn a little more about the Mass. It certainly explains the Biblical origins of the Mass and the nature of sacrifice and oblation. It is a truly enlightening book yet easy to read.
